以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- 请教怎么动态设置数据格式? (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=42761) |
-- 作者:heying325 -- 发布时间:2013/11/21 11:58:00 -- 请教怎么动态设置数据格式? 我想对指定行的所有数字设为百分比的,我改怎么弄呢?? |
-- 作者:Bin -- 发布时间:2013/11/21 12:00:00 -- DataTables("表A").DataCols("ddd").SetFormat("#0.00%") |
-- 作者:heying325 -- 发布时间:2013/11/21 12:50:00 -- 版主,你好! 可是这样的话就会将整个列设置成了百分比,我只想让这列部分的数据设为百分!!请问有什么办法? |
-- 作者:狐狸爸爸 -- 发布时间:2013/11/21 14:15:00 -- 用DrawCell事件,可以根据条件按指定格式显示。
if e.col.name = "某列" then if 条件成立 then e.Text = format(val(e.text),"#0.00%") end if end if |